Field of Valor July 1–13 | Irvine Civic Center Lawn

The City of Irvine, in partnership with the Irvine 2/11 Marine Adoption Committee, is hosting the Fourth of July Field of Valor event, July 1–13, at the Irvine Civic Center Lawn. Honor veterans, active duty, and fallen service members by visiting the flag display. For more information and to submit a sponsorship request, visit cityofirvine.org/fieldofvalor . Irvine Annual (formerly All Media) July 12–August 30 | Opening Reception: July 12, 2–4 p.m. | Irvine Fine Arts Center Formerly All Media , Irvine Annual continues its legacy as a premier juried exhibition showcasing California artists. Irvine Fine Arts Center is pleased to announce its 41st annual juried exhibition. This year’s guest jurors include Elizabeth Munzon, Stephanie Sherwood, and Dakota Noot.
